About the Provider
Parker Montessori believes that within each child is the seed of unlimited potential which will guide the child into adulthood. We emphasize individualized education as opposed to strict curricular education while utilizing many types of curricula. Each child is educated at his or her own rate of development. Our focus is to continually stimulate the child through an enriched environment with activities, materials, and extensions that promote experimentation at every developmental level. In essence, we offer the world on a silver platter knowing that the innate curiosity of children will promote independence, exploration, experimentation and creativity. These goals of nurturing curiosity and independence are balanced with our goals of developing responsibility and self-discipline. Defined limits and modeled expectations are set through curriculum standards as well as through student coded of conduct and discipline. Each child is offered opportunities to grow within the context of respect for themselves, the environment and the people with which he/she shares the world. These concepts are the core of Dr. Montessori's philosophy of education.
Celebrating 25 years of excellence in Montessori preschool education serving infants, toddlers, preschool, and Kindergarten in Parker, Colorado. The only Montessori infant- Kindergarten daycare in Parker that is accredited through American Montessori Society - meaning the ONLY true Montessori preschool in Parker..
Our students range from 12 months to 6 years of age. Our 3-6 year olds enjoy the benefits of multi-age classrooms. Our families come to us from many parts of Colorado, but we are closest to Parker, Centennial, Castle Rock, Elizabeth, Franktown and Aurora. Our students are encouraged to explore, learn and excel under the gentle guidance of our highly experienced staff.
